About Shauna Somerville's research
Shauna Somerville is a researcher in plant-microbe interactions, plant cell wall and powdery mildews at Professor of Plant and Microbial Biology, UC Berkeley. Their work has been cited 24,034 times across 169 publications (h-index 69), according to Google Scholar.
Their most-cited work, “Sugar transporters for intercellular exchange and nutrition of pathogens” (2010), has accumulated 1,896 citations. Other influential works include “Coordinated plant defense responses in Arabidopsis revealed by microarray analysis” (2000) with 1,845 citations and “SNARE-protein-mediated disease resistance at the plant cell wall” (2003) with 1,188 citations.
